Living By Revealed Truth

The Life and Pastoral Theology of Charles Haddon Spurgeon

Tom Nettles · Christian Focus

The most academically comprehensive biography of Spurgeon available. Nettles meticulously documents Spurgeon’s journey from his earliest years through his final controversy — examining his preaching, his theological convictions, and the full arc of his pastoral ministry.

This is the most textbook-like of the Spurgeon biographies. Nettles meticulously documents Spurgeon’s life, highlighting his conversion to Christianity at a young age and his rapid ascent to prominence as a Baptist preacher.

The book offers insights into Spurgeon’s preaching style, his commitment to the inerrancy of Scripture, and his staunch defense of Reformed theology. It also explores the many challenges Spurgeon faced, including controversies within the church, his battle with depression, and his enduring physical ailments. Nettles uses a wealth of historical material to paint a detailed portrait of Spurgeon, making it an essential read for those interested in Christian history and pastoral theology. The book is not just a biography but also an exploration of Spurgeon’s theological beliefs and how they influenced his pastoral work.
